The structure had 31 rooms in a larger rectangular courtyard which was protected by high walls. All the rooms within the courtyard have dome shaped roof above a quadrangular frame. The largest of buildings with the complex was the central hall, whose dome can be seen towering above the outer walls. The Caravanserai would have provided shelter for both humans and animals.

Tash-Rabat means ‘stone yard’ in Kyrgyz and is a very apt name for a very big enclosure which is 33.7metres by 35.7 metres.
